self-subsistent Meaning
self-subsistent
subsisting independently of anything external to itself
self-subsistent Sentence Examples
- The remote island community is self-subsistent, providing all its own food, water, and shelter.
- The self-subsistent homestead includes a vegetable garden, livestock, and a renewable energy system.
- The tribe has maintained its self-subsistent lifestyle for centuries, living in harmony with the surrounding environment.
